The jackpot quantity in lotteries accumulates over time from ticket gross sales and is often influenced by the principles set by the lottery group. A portion of every ticket sold contributes to the jackpot, which explains why massive lotteries, like Mega Millions or Powerball, can attain eye-popping figures typically exceeding $1 billion. Furthermore, when a jackpot remains unclaimed for consecutive drawings, the prize quantity rolls over, leading to even larger sums. It's essential to assume about that while the advertised jackpot is commonly huge, the lump-sum possibility tends to significantly scale back the amount acquired due to taxes. For instance, a $1 billion jackpot might translate to approximately $600 million after taxes if taken as a lump sum. Thus, understanding how jackpot funds accumulate gives perception into not just the joy surrounding giant payouts but also the sudden financial implications for winners.

Many gamers develop private methods when choosing their lottery numbers. One well-liked methodology includes selecting significant dates corresponding to birthdays or anniversaries. While this approach personalizes the experience, it typically limits numbers to 1-31, neglecting higher options that could yield potential winnings. Alternatively, some players go for fast picks, permitting the machine to randomly choose numbers. While this technique removes the burden of decision-making, it doesn't guarantee enhanced odds compared to non-random choice. Understanding these strategies can empower players to make more informed decisions while collaborating in the sport.
